Residents press Port Richey to revive Cody River Landing plans; council schedules workshop for Jan. 23

Port Richey City Council / Town Hall · December 3, 2025
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

At a town-hall public comment period, residents urged the city to restore roads, sidewalks and lighting at Cody River Landing. Council members responded and set a January 23 workshop to coordinate county and developer participation on staging and funding.

Residents at the Port Richey town hall urged the council to revive plans for the Cody River Landing area and invest in basic infrastructure to attract businesses and improve safety.
